## TwigSweep Runbook — stale-branch cleanup bot

TwigSweep prunes branches idle for 90+ days on the Ferngate monorepo. Reviewers: confirm `SWEEP_DRY_RUN=false` only after the weekly report looks sane. The bot needs repo-admin scope to delete refs, and that credential goes in the env file on the line that follows.

env line for fafof-fahag: LEDGER_TOKEN5=f8790

Subject: SDK parity cut-over summary

Team,

The cut-over finished this morning: the Mossvale JavaScript SDK now matches the Kotlin SDK feature-for-feature, and both hit the unified Tidemark endpoint. Retry handling, pagination, and offline queueing behave identically, so you no longer need platform-specific workarounds in tickets. Older JS clients remain supported for ninety days on the compatibility shim. Both SDKs ship pointing at the following default configuration.

config for kafof-bawef:
holath:
  log_level: debug
  metrics_host: metrics.holath.qorvelsys.internal
  pin: 2191
  pool_size: 32

- [ ] **Step 7: Breaker override escrow.** After sealing the signing keys for the Tallgrove upstream API circuit breaker, confirm the support team can force the breaker open during a full outage. The override bundle lives in the sealed escrow drawer and is useless without its unlock phrase. Two ceremony witnesses must initial this step before proceeding. The escrow bundle is decrypted with the recovery passphrase that follows.

vault phrase of kahip-kahop = holath-quenmir

**Ticket: Undo/redo stack drift in SketchLoom staging**

The SketchLoom diagram editor on staging is reverting shapes two steps instead of one, while production behaves correctly. We traced this to configuration drift introduced during last week's manual hotfix: the history-depth and debounce settings were edited in place and never committed. Please reconcile staging against the canonical values listed below.

config for hahip-kaguf:
[holath]
port = 8443
region = north-4
host = holath.tolvaqlabs.internal
timeout_ms = 1000
retries = 2